Job description

Job Title

Manager, Tooling Engineering

Job Location

Redmond WA

Job Schedule

9/80: Employees work 9 out of every 14 days - totaling 80 hours worked - and have every other Friday off

Job Description

We are seeking an experienced and skilled Manager, Tooling Engineering with a background in tooling design, fabrication, and manufacturing support. The successful candidate will be responsible for leading a team of tooling engineers to develop, implement, and optimize tooling solutions that ensure the highest quality and efficiency in production. This position requires a proactive and hands-on leadership approach, working collaboratively with cross-functional teams and suppliers to address and resolve issues, drive continuous improvements, and uphold our stringent quality standards. This role requires complete ownership of the tooling engineering function from concept to production support. We’re looking for someone who is highly invested in the tooling solutions their team develops and genuinely enjoys getting hands-on with tooling design and implementation. The ideal candidate thrives on the shop floor, takes personal ownership of their team's tooling deliverables, and finds satisfaction in directly engaging with the hardware, production teams, and suppliers to solve real-world manufacturing challenges. You must deeply understand not just how to design and build tooling, but the products being manufactured - their design intent, functionality, and critical features - to effectively translate production requirements into successful tooling solutions.

Ideal Candidate
  • The ideal candidate will possess strong technical expertise, proven leadership capabilities, and a high level of self-motivation.
Essential Functions
  • Lead and develop a team of tooling engineers, providing technical guidance, mentorship, and performance management
  • Read and interpret engineering drawings and manufacturing requirements to guide tooling strategy and design that produces conforming hardware
  • Take full ownership of tooling engineering deliverables, serving as the primary technical authority from initial concept through production implementation
  • Develop a comprehensive understanding of product design, functionality, and manufacturing requirements to ensure tooling solutions support product performance and quality objectives
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including design engineering, manufacturing engineering, quality, production, and suppliers to ensure successful program execution
  • Oversee the development of clear, comprehensive tooling documentation including design specifications, assembly instructions, and maintenance procedures. Ensure documentation effectively bridges engineering intent with shop floor execution
  • Manage tooling budgets, schedules, and resource allocation to meet program commitments
  • Establish and maintain tooling standards, best practices, and design guidelines
  • Participate in and lead continuous improvement initiatives and contribute to the development of organizational best practices
  • Provide design for manufacturability feedback with emphasis on tooling requirements and constraints
  • Design and implement process improvements to enhance tooling effectiveness, productivity, quality, and cost-efficiency
  • Manage relationships with external tooling suppliers and vendors
  • Ensure compliance with safety regulations and quality standards for all tooling operations
